Ro System Installation Questions
What is involved in installing an RO system? Installation typically includes mounting the unit, connecting it to the water supply, and setting up the filtration components for proper operation.
Can an RO system be installed in any home? Most homes with standard water supplies can accommodate an RO system, but space and water pressure considerations may affect suitability.
What types of properties request RO system installation? Residential properties, including homes and apartments, often seek RO systems to improve drinking water quality.
What should property owners know before installation? It's important to consider available space, water quality, and existing plumbing to ensure proper system setup and performance.
